Ulagalla Resort wins Gold at National Green Awards

Ulagalla Resort received the Presidential Gold Award for the industry best eco practices, which encourage businesses to go beyond compliances to protect the environment while giving more knowledge to the public and private sector on green initiatives.

The awards ceremony was held recently under the patronage of President Mahinda Rajapaksa at the BMICH. This is the first ever Presidential Awards recognising 'greener' businesses.

Ulagalla is a L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) certified resort with 'Silver' rating by the United States Green Building Council (USGBC). Rain water harvesting, biogas powered lighting on path ways, non-motorised activities, organic fruit and vegetable garden, are a few of the environment-friendly practices being carried out.

One important principle of sustainable construction is repair and reuse of existing facilities.

In this context, a decision was taken to restore the Walawwa with minimum new material.
